我们提供一站式网上办事大厅招投标所需全套资料,包括师生办事大厅介绍PPT、一网通办平台产品解决方案、
师生服务大厅产品技术参数,以及对应的标书参考文件,详请联系客服。
小明:最近我在研究“一网通办平台”,感觉它和.NET有什么关系吗?
小李:当然有!很多政务服务系统都是基于.NET构建的,特别是ASP.NET Core,非常适合做高并发、高性能的Web服务。
小明:那你能举个例子吗?
小李:比如,你可以用C#写一个简单的API来对接“一网通办”的用户认证模块。
小明:具体怎么操作呢?
小李:我们可以创建一个ASP.NET Core项目,然后定义一个Controller来处理登录请求。
小明:那代码是怎样的?
小李:下面是一个简单的示例:
[ApiController] [Route("api/[controller]")] public class AuthController : ControllerBase { [HttpPost] public IActionResult Login([FromBody] LoginModel model) { if (model.Username == "admin" && model.Password == "123456") { return Ok(new { Token = "JWT_TOKEN_HERE" }); } return Unauthorized(); } } public class LoginModel { public string Username { get; set; } public string Password { get; set; } }
小明:这看起来不错,但怎么和“一网通办平台”对接呢?
小李:通常需要配置跨域(CORS)并使用OAuth2或JWT进行身份验证,确保安全性和兼容性。
小明:明白了,看来.NET在政务系统中确实很重要。
小李:没错,它提供了强大的工具链,让开发更高效,维护也更方便。